본문 바로가기

Grid

(6)
css minmax 사용법 css minmax 사용법 : grid로 레이아웃을 만들 때 많이 사용. 문법 : min 보다 크거나 같고, max 보다 같거나 작은 단위 minmax(min, max); 예시 : .grid-container { display: grid; grid-template-rows: repeat(2, minmax(20px, auto)); grid-template-columns: minmax(30px, auto) repeat(3, 1fr); } 참고 : https://developer.mozilla.org/en-US/docs/Web/CSS/minmax minmax() - CSS: Cascading Style Sheets | MDN The minmax() CSS function defines a size range ..
w2ui 그리드에서 recid를 가져오는 여러가지 방법과 기타등등 w2ui recid를 가져오는 여러가지 방법과 기타등등 w2ui로 작업하다가 까먹지 않기 위해 오늘도 블로그에 메모! w2ui["myGrid"].records[0]["recid"] w2ui["myGrid"].get(1) const recidNum = 1; //-1을 해준이유는 recid는 1부터 시작하는데 배열은 0부터 시작 w2ui["myGrid"].records[recidNum-1]["fieldName1"]; w2ui["myGrid"].records[recidNum-1]["fieldName2"]; 자세한 사용법은 나중에 올리겠다고 다짐하고 일단 포스팅!!
w2ui recid:undefined recid가 null 일 때 w2ui 라이브러리를 사용중인데, JAVA에서 값을 조회해서 js로 다시 반환할 때, List 이렇게 만들어준 데이터의 모양이었다. [ {REG_DT=2023-06-15 12:00:00, SPOT_ID=CS000001, SPOT_NM=출고장, IP=236.258.459.126, MDFCN_DT=2023-06-15 17:00:00}, {REG_DT=2023-06-15 16:21:33, SPOT_ID=CS0000022, SPOT_NM=nameName, IP=123.123.123.123} ] 뭐 이런 모양의 데이터..... js로 받아서 w2ui에서 이렇게 넣어줬는데, w2ui["vInfoGrid"].records = JSON.parse(data.list); w2ui의 특성상 recid가 필요하다. w2ui ..
w2ui 그리드 undefined 나서 데이터가 안들어 갈 때 w2ui그리드 사용중에... 이런적이 없었는데 이유를 알 수 없는 undefined 때문에.. w2ui grid에 데이터가 들어갔다가, 안들어갔다가... 간혈적인 증상 때문에 이유를 알 수 없었음. 검색을 하다가 하다가 찾게 된 이 댓글을 보고 힌트를 얻음. https://www.phpschool.com/gnuboard4/bbs/board.php?bo_table=qna_html&wr_id=265237 WWW.PHPSCHOOL.COM 개발자 커뮤니티 1위 PHPSCHOOL.COM 입니다. www.phpschool.com 결론 : w2ui 그리드에 데이터가 뿌려지는 속도보다 그리드가 만들어지는 속도가 느려서 undefined 값이 간혈적으로 일어남. 이유는 상세정보 form 쪽에 게이트웨이 select bo..
tabulator 그리드 무한대로 늘어나는 현상 display grid와 width auto infinite 원인 : tabulator 그리드 옵션 중 layout과 display:grid의 단위 1fr과 width: auto;와 position:absolute의 속성들이 만나서 생긴 현상. 부모와 조상 엘리먼트 중에서 고정값이 있어야 하는데 없어서 무한대로 늘어남. 해결방법 : 1. tabulator 옵션 layout : "fitColumns", 주석처리. 2. tabulator 감싸고 있는 바로 위 부모의 width:auto를 고정값으로 변경. 3. display:grid가 적용된 div의 grid-template-columns의 1fr 속성값을 고정값으로 변경. 4. #contents의 position:absolute의 값을 relative로 변경하면서 그 아래 자식들의 엘리먼트들의 구조를 변경해야함. 회..
w2ui 날짜와 시간이 함께 있는 필드에서 시간만 보이게 하고 싶을 때, render로 해결 상황요약 : - w2ui를 사용하여 DB값을 웹에 뿌려주고 있음. - FIELD_NAME1_DATE의 값이 '2022-01-17 10:00:00' 이런식으로 나오는데, 시간만 '10:00:00'만 필요한 상황. - 차트에는 날짜가 들어가야 그래프가 나오기 때문에 SQL을 건드리지 말아야 했었음. - w2ui docs를 참고하여 해결. 수정전 : columns: [ { field: 'FIELD_NAME1_DATE', caption: '캡션1', size: '28%' }, { field: 'FIELD_NAME2', caption: '캡션2', size: '18%' }, { field: 'FIELD_NAME3', caption: '캡션3', size: '18%' }, { field: 'FIELD_NAME4',..